Montgomery: Where History Comes Alive

Step back in time and immerse yourself in the rich tapestry of Montgomery, Alabama. This vibrant city pulsates with memories that have shaped not just the South, but the very fabric of the Country. From its grand beginnings as a riverfront trading post to its Rock Springs pivotal role in the Civil Rights Movement, Montgomery offers an immersive journey through time.

Wander through memorials like the Rosa Parks Museum and the Legacy Museum, where you can experience firsthand the struggles and triumphs of a nation grappling with justice. Or take a stroll down Dexter Avenue, where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. once preached his message of hope, and feel the echoes of history in every brick and stone. America's Launchpad: Huntsville

Nestled in the heart of Alabama, Huntsville is known as "Space City, USA." This vibrant city has become a global center for the aerospace industry, drawing top professionals and fostering advancement. From its humble beginnings as a textile community, Huntsville has transformed into a booming center of science and technology.
